Whether inside our body or outside, the flu virus and the common cold alike survive better in a colder rather than hot environment. So during winter, more microbes are around for us to catch, while cocooning inside also increases the chances of cross contamination with other people. Once inside our body, not keeping warm enough can also cause them to replicate faster. So remember to dress warmly next time you go out in the cold!
